Color Key
Color A: Black Color B: Grey

Important Notes:
ü This entire pattern is crochet with TWO STRANDS of medium 4 ply yarn
ü Hook Size: 5.5mm
ü The actual lengths of sizes are listed in Content above. This is the length of
the blanket from shoulder to floor. Not height of blanket wearer.
ü If gauge is not used, correct sizing is not guaranteed
ü For all Double Crochet Rows, Chain 2 and Turn at the End of the Row.
Begin to DC in the 1st stitch of the next Row, do not count Chain as a stitch.
Terms Used
SS: Slip Stitch DC: Double Crochet
SC: Single Crochet DCS: Decrease
HDC: Half Double Crochet TR: Triple/Treble Crochet

Gauge: 11 DC and 6 ½ Rows equals 4 by 4 inches


Yardage and Yarn Used (This is only an estimate)
Color A Color B
Caron Simply Soft Black Grey
Toddler 1,400 450
Child 2,000 600
Adult 2,550 750
Adult Large 2,700 800

Assembly

Basic Assembly:
Everything is sewn on using a yarn needle and matching yarn (Picture 1). The
first thing to be sewn before anything else is the Bat Symbol onto the chest
(Picture 2). After the symbol is in place, position all the pieces onto the cape
before sewing them down. The legs go underneath the shorts (Picture 3) and
are sewn down before the shirt and shorts. The shirt lays a few inches above
where the middle of the cape ends. Stop sewing the shirt down to the cape
about 2 inches below the armpit (Picture 4).

28
Cape Shoulders Assembly:
Once everything is sewn onto the cape, the shirt should lay on top of the cape
shoulders as shown in Picture 5. Fold over the cape shoulder, running it along
the sleeves and attaching the tip of the cape to the front of the shirt (Picture 6).
Sew along the arm opening attaching it to the cape shoulder. Be sure to leave
the arm hole open to allow for the arms of the wearer to slip into the opening.

Bat Ears: Make two
Row 1: (With Color A) Ch 12. 12sts
Row 2: HDC in the third ch from the hook, HDC across. 10sts
Row 3-4: HDC across. 10sts
Row 5-10: DCS, HDC across. 4sts
Row 11: DCS twice. 2sts
Row 12: DCS. 1st
Row 13: SS. 1st

Attaching Ears:
First position the ears on the hat where you want them to lay and fasten them
down with safety pins or place markers. With a needle and black yarn, sew
around the edges of the ears to attach them to the hat. Do not stitch down the
tips of the ear to the hat. The tips are to remain free and unattached so that
the stick up.
